CVE-2024-36378

CVSS 3.1 Score 5.9 of 10 (medium)

Details

Published May 29, 2024
CWE ID 770

Summary

CVE-2024-36378 is a denial-of-service (DoS) vulnerability affecting JetBrains TeamCity versions prior to 2024.03.2. Maliciously crafted authentication tokens can be used to trigger the vulnerability and cause the server to become unresponsive, resulting in a denial-of-service condition. An attacker can exploit this issue by supplying invalid tokens to the server, causing it to consume significant resources in processing the requests, ultimately leading to a degraded user experience or even server downtime. To mitigate this risk, users are advised to upgrade to TeamCity version 2024.03.2 or later as soon as possible.
